阶段 | 实训主题 | 实训内容 | 实训天数 |
1.网络工程 | 计算机网络 | Linux云计算课程体系介绍、IP地址概述、IP地址配置及连通性测试 | 6 |
计算机网络概述、数制转换、OSI参考模型、TCP/IP协议 | |||
物理层解析、交换机命令行操作 | |||
数据链路层解析、交换机基本配置 | |||
IP包格式及IP地址、网络层协议及设备、静态路由、默认路由、浮动路由 | |||
传输层解析、TCP/UDP详解、应用层解析 | |||
路由与交换技术 | VLAN与Trunk技术、以太通道EtherChannel、DHCP技术 | 5 | |
三层交换、动态路由RIP | |||
HSRP热备份路由协议、STP生成树协议 | |||
ACL访问控制列表 | |||
NAT地址转换协议 | |||
阶段项目实战 | 企业网络架构在线升级 | 1 |
阶段 | 实训主题 | 实训内容 | 实训天数 |
2. Linux基础 | Linux系统管理 | Linux系统简介、Linux系统安装部署、RHEL6基本操作 | 14 |
Linux命令行基础、目录与文件管理 | |||
Linux文件内容操作、归档及压缩解压、文件查找之find详解 | |||
Vim文本编辑器、RPM软件包管理 | |||
YUM软件包管理、源代码编译安装部署 | |||
Linux用户账户与组账户管理 | |||
Linux系统管理综合案例一 | |||
Linux权限管理、特殊权限、ACL权限 | |||
磁盘管理、扩展SWAP空间、文件系统管理 | |||
LVM逻辑卷管理、RAID磁盘整列管理、Linux下服务管理 | |||
计划任务、进程管理、Linux启动流程分析 | |||
查看及测试网络、配置网络地址 | |||
Linux远程控制、系统日志管理、Logrotate日志轮转、系统故障排除 | |||
Linux系统管理综合案例二 | |||
Linux网络服务 | Vsftpd服务详解 | 12 | |
Web基础应用、虚拟Web主机、LAMP平台构建、PHP应用部署 | |||
DNS基础应用、多区域及特殊解析、构建主/从DNS | |||
DHCP构建与维护、PXE网络装机、无人值守安装Linux | |||
包过滤防火墙、iptables基本管理、filter表控制、iptables状态控制 | |||
Linux网络服务综合案例一(企业级批量装机方案) | |||
虚拟化概述、构建KVM平台、管理KVM虚拟机 | |||
KVM命令管理、虚拟机Qcow2应用 | |||
DNS子域授权、Split分离解析、缓存DNS服务器 | |||
邮件系统概述、Postfix发信服务、Dovecot收信服务、SMTP认证控制 | |||
EMOS邮件部署、Rsync+Inotify实时同步配置、 sersync | |||
iptables扩展匹配、nat表典型应用、防火墙脚本 | |||
阶段项目实战 | 服务器选型/IDC介绍 | 1 |
阶段 | 实训主题 | 实训内容 | 实训天数 | ||
3. 自动化运维 | Shell编程 | Shell概述、编写及执行脚本、Shell变量 | 7 | ||
数值运算、条件测试、if选择结构 | |||||
循环结构、服务脚本设计、函数及终端控制 | |||||
字符串处理、扩展的脚本技巧、正则表达式 | |||||
Sed基本用法、Sed文本块处理、Sed高级应用 | |||||
Awk基本用法、Awk高级应用 | |||||
Shell企业实战案例 | |||||
Linux高级运维 | 常见的缓存服务开源解决方案、Squid服务器、Http协议缓存实战Varnish详解 | 7 | |||
Nginx服务器、Nginx虚拟主机、Nginx反向代理 | |||||
部署LNMP、Nginx+FastCGI、Nginx高级技术、Nginx常见问题 | |||||
Memcached原理、部署Memcached、Session共享 | |||||
Tomcat服务器安装与配置、Tomcat高级应用 | |||||
Redis组件、Redis认证、Redis复制 | |||||
Linux监控 | 监控概述、Nagios监控服务、Nagios监控案例 | 3 | |||
Cacti监控服务器、Cacti监控案例 | |||||
Zabbix监控机制、Zabbix报警机制 | |||||
阶段项目实战 | 网站架构的演化 | 1 | |||
阶段 | 实训主题 | 实训内容 | 实训天数 |
4.数据库与安全 | MySQL数据库管理 | 数据库服务概述、构建MySQL服务器、MySQL数据类型、表结构的调整 | 7 |
MySQL多实例、MySQL索引类型、MySQL存储引擎 | |||
表记录基本操作、查询及匹配条件、多表查询、数据导入导出、MySQL分割 | |||
库表 | |||
用户授权及撤销、数据备份与恢复、MySQL管理工具 | |||
实时增量备份、XtraBackup备份、MySQL主从同步 | |||
MySQL读写分离、MySQL性能调优 | |||
Linux安全应用 | Linux基本防护、引导和登录控制、用户切换与提权、SSH访问控制 | 3 | |
SELinux安全防护、加密与解密、CA数字证书服务 | |||
配置HTTP SSL、邮件服务TLS/SSL、扫描与抓包 | |||
阶段项目实战 | MySQL企业实战 | 1 |
阶段 | 实训主题 | 实训内容 | 实训天数 |
5. 云计算 | Linux集群与存储 | iSCSI技术应用、udev配置、NFS网络文件系统、构建IP SAN | 5 |
FastDFS安装、FastDFS配置、FastDFS部署 | |||
集群及LVS简介、LVS-NAT集群、LVS-DR集群 | |||
HAProxy服务器、KeepAlived热备、KeepAlived+LVS | |||
RHCS概述、搭建RHCS集群环境、RHCS高可用服务器 | |||
Python开发基础 | Python概述、Python起步、数据类型、判断语句 | 3 | |
循环语句、文件对象、函数、模块 | |||
异常处理、正则表达式、多线程 | |||
RHEL7与RHEL6差异 | systemctl系统管理、nmcli网络配置、XFS文件系统管理 | 2 | |
GRUB启动设置调整、firewall-cmd配置防火墙策略 | |||
云计算部署与管理 | 云计算基础、IaaS云组件分析、阿里云概述、弹性伸缩及方案实施 | 6 | |
阿里云ECS简介及购买流程、ECS操作指南、ECS应用案例(Web、集群等) | |||
阿里云数据库RDS介绍、RDS操作指南、CDN内容分发技术介绍、CDN控制台管理 | |||
OpenStack组件概述、OpenStack自动化部署、OpenStack功能预览 | |||
RabbitMQ消息队列、Keystone认证服务、Neutron网络管理 | |||
Swift对象存储、Glance镜像服务、Cinder块服务、Nova控制节点及计算节点 | |||
项目实战 | PXE+Kickstart实现无人值守部署+系统优化 | 2 | |
企业级监控系统部署构建CDN分发网络 |
第一阶段
Linux系统管理实战
01 打开计算机世界的大门
行业分析、计算机基础、 Windows server基础、网络基础
02 Linux基本管理
Linux安装、Linux常规命令、文本编辑器
03 Linux软件与文件系统
软件管理、文件系统管理 、高级文件系统管理
04 Linux用户与权限管理
Linux用户管理、Linux权限管理
05 Shell编程精讲
Shell基础、Shell编程 、Shell实例
06 Linux系统管理
Linux启动管理 、Linux服务管理、Linux系统管理 、日志管理、数据备份与恢复
07 Python脚本编程
Python数据类型 、Python语法、Python函数 、Python常用模块
第二阶段
Linux网络服务实战
01 Linux服务管理
DHCP服务器配置、SSH服务器配置 、VNC服务、DNS域名系统、Postfix邮件服务器
02 Linux文件服务器实战
Vsftp服务器配置 、Samba服务器配置 、NFS网络文件系统 、Rsync数据同步
03 Web服务器实战
LAMP架构部署、Apache服务器、LNMP架构部署、Nginx服务器配置
04 数据库实战
MySQL数据库管理 、NoSQL数据库集群
第三阶段
数据库集群和虚拟化
01 负载均衡集群与高可用性集群实战
集群部署、负载均衡集群、网络存储 、高可用性集群
02 监控集群实战
cacti监控集群、zabbix监控集群
03 云计算集群与虚拟化集群实战
Openstack云计算集群、虚拟化集群、虚拟化容器docker
04 大数据实战
分布式文件系统Hadoop
05 Linux安全防护实战
安全管理、iptables防火墙